Steelers right tackle Marcus Gilbert has been ruled out of Monday night’s game vs. Houston with a concussion, the team announced.
Mike Adams replaced Gilbert at right tackle for Pittsburgh, which holds a 24-13 lead at halftime.
The 26-year-old Gilbert has started all six games for the Steelers this season. He signed a contract extension with the club in August.
Gilbert will have to be cleared via the NFL’s concussion protocols to return to practice and game action.
